A captivating piece of early 20th-century Canadian art.
This is a beautiful, large-format antique original watercolor painting dating to 1902, believed to depict a bustling harbor scene in Montreal, Canada. The painting has a wonderful historical quality, rendered in a subdued, atmospheric palette of blues, grays, and warm browns, characteristic of early 20th-century marine art.
The focal point is a schooner-style boat tied up at a wooden dock, with additional vessels and industrial buildings visible in the background, suggesting a busy, working port. The painting is attributed to A.S. Brodeur, (was purchased with several other watercolors by Brodeur). This painting is a rare, century-old window into Canada's maritime past and would make an exceptional addition to a collection of Canadian, marine, or vintage watercolor art.
